Buying Guide: Key Considerations For Ninja Toys

  • Age appropriateness: Look for sets labeled 6+ or higher to align with a six-year-old’s dexterity and safety guidelines. Some remote-control toys may require adult supervision for younger users.
  • Type of play: Balance RC vehicles, building sets, and action figures to support different play styles—imaginative role-play, problem-solving, and physical activity.
  • Durability and safety: Rubber or soft plastics with rounded edges tend to withstand rough play. Check for non-toxic materials and included safety instructions.
  • Ease of use: Remote controls should be intuitive; building sets should have clear instructions and modest piece counts to avoid frustration.
  • Educational value: Consider sets that encourage fine motor skills, sequencing, planning, and storytelling to complement creative play.
  • Maintenance and replacements: Some parts (such as LEGO minifigures or RC components) may require occasional replacement parts. Check spare-parts availability.
  • Storage and portability: Larger sets and inflatable toys benefit from a dedicated storage solution to keep components organized and accessible.
  • Interests and themes: Ninja-themed products from TMNT or LEGO NINJAGO merge familiar characters with action-packed play to boost engagement.
